Iowa vs Wisconsin: EV Charging Analysis
Wisconsin leads with 926 EV charging stations and 2,466 ports, while neighboring Iowa has 505 stations and 1,343 ports. Wisconsin has 36% DC fast charging ports compared to Iowa's 42%, which matters for road trips between these states. Both states are served by major charging networks including ChargePoint, Tesla, and Electrify America.
